Indigenous Brilliance & Art Ecosystem presents Earthseed Book Club, a youth-led literary project which explores community building and liberation through Black & Indigenous speculative fiction and political theory.
In the final episode of season 2, Art Ecosystem members Lexi and Karmella chat with friend and community member Kílila Raine (Squamish Nation) about transformative justice, harm reduction and accountability processes in the context of self care, community care, renewal and growth.
In Episode 2: Futurism and Cyber Gardening, co-hosts Karmella Benedito De Barros and Lexi Mellish Mingo chat with Whitney French of Hush Harbour Press about the concept of cyber gardening and creating connections and community both online and offline.
In episode one “Love As Rest”, co-hosts Karmella and Lexi chat about intentional rest as a form of resistance and a necessary practice in sustainable growth and meaningful revolutionary change making.
